MYSQL无法在D盘进行安装(mysql不能安装d盘吗)

MYSQL无法在D盘进行安装?

如果你正在尝试在Windows操作系统中安装MYSQL数据库,但在选择安装目录时却无法安装到D盘,甚至无法进行选择D盘的操作,这可能是因为权限不足或磁盘格式问题导致的。不过,不要担心,下面我们将为您提供一些可能的解决方案。

1. 检查权限

在大多数情况下,无法在D盘进行安装的问题是由于权限不足所导致的。如果当前的用户不是管理员,尝试在管理员权限下运行安装程序。

方法:右键点击安装程序,选择“以管理员身份运行”,如下图所示:

![以管理员身份运行](https://cdn.learnku.com/uploads/images/202201/05/49164/8W5DBZdf0i.png!large)

2. 更改磁盘格式

如果你的D盘是NTFS格式,并且你尝试安装的MYSQL版本为5.5及以上,那么你可能会遇到无法在D盘进行安装的问题。这是因为从MYSQL 5.5开始,它将需要在安装目录中创建执行文件的符号链接,而NTFS格式默认禁用了符号链接。因此,你需要更改D盘的NTFS格式以允许符号链接的使用。

方法:打开Windows命令提示符,输入以下命令并运行:

fsutil behavior set SymlinkEvaluation R2R:1

然后在安装MYSQL时选择D盘即可。

3. 安装到C盘后移动文件

如果你尝试以上方法还无法解决问题,那么你可以选择将MYSQL安装到C盘,然后将其移动到D盘上。这也是一个常见的解决方案。

方法:先安装MYSQL到C盘,然后在安装完毕后,将MYSQL文件夹从C盘复制到D盘。接着,在D盘中的MYSQL文件夹中创建.bat文件,并使用以下代码:

@echo off
set dest=D:\MYSQL
set source=C:\MYSQL
echo.
echo Shutting down server, if running
echo ------------------------------
echo.
"%source%\bin\mysqladmin" -u root shutdown
echo.
echo Copying contents into %dest%
echo ----------------------------------------
echo.
xcopy "%source%\*.*" "%dest%\" /e /i /h /k /y
echo.
echo Starting up new server
echo --------------------------
echo.
"%dest%\bin\mysqld" --install
sc start MySQL
echo.
echo Done!
echo ------
echo.
pause

将以上代码保存为.bat文件后,运行并等待数据库复制到D盘,然后你就可以使用D盘中的MYSQL文件夹了。

总结

以上是解决MYSQL无法在D盘进行安装的三种常见方法。如果你遇到了相同的问题,不妨选择其中的一种方法进行尝试。希望以上解决方案能帮助到你!


数据运维技术 » MYSQL无法在D盘进行安装(mysql不能安装d盘吗)